Analysis
The most recent figure for gross enrolment ratio, lower secondary, both sexes in ECA: Non-oil Ldcs (unsdcode:98120) is 42.0%, measured in 2023.
The figure is down 2.4% on the previous year and down 1.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, gross enrolment ratio, lower secondary, both sexes in ECA: Non-oil Ldcs (unsdcode:98120) peaked at 43.5% in 2014 and was at its lowest, 15.0%, in 1993.
That places ECA: Non-oil Ldcs (unsdcode:98120) 219th out of 221 groups with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 31 years of available data.
